David Rothkopf, foreign policy writer and podcaster, analyzes Trump’s Iran speech and its fallout. He dissects the baffling ‘Strait of Hormuz’ remark. He explores the administration’s lack of clear objectives and its damage to alliances. He details the political risks for Republicans and argues for fresh Democratic leadership and policy renewal.

Trump Washes Hands Of Strait Of Hormuz
- Trump told other countries to 'go to the strait and just take it' and said the Strait of Hormuz will 'open up naturally.'
- Rothkopf interprets this as Trump washing his hands of reopening the strait and shifting responsibility to allies and importers.
Broke It You Fix It Narcissist Politics
- Rothkopf says Trump’s posture is 'I broke it, you fix it,' shifting blame for consequences he created.
- He ties this to Trump's anger at NATO allies for not joining an unconsulted invasion and threatens alliance cohesion.
Ignored War Games Forecast Strategic Failure
- Rothkopf emphasizes the absence of a functioning National Security Council process under Trump, worsening strategic risks.
- He references past war games showing the U.S. lost an attack-on-Iran scenario because Iran can leverage the Strait of Hormuz.
